네트워크의 구조#
- 네트워크: 컴퓨터를 두 대 이상 연결하여 서로 데이터를 전송할 수 있는 통신망
- 인터넷: TCP/IP 프로토콜을 사용하는 세계 규모의 네트워크다. 전 세계의 컴퓨터를 서로 연결하여 정보를 교환할 수 있도록 만든 하나의 컴퓨터 통신망이다.
- 패킷: 네트워크 통신을 할 때 사용되는 작게 분할되는 데이터의 기본 단위다.
- 패킷으로 나누지 않고 한 번에 큰 데이터를 그대로 보내면 네트워크의 대역폭을 너무 차지해서 다른 패킷의 흐름을 막을 수도 있기 때문이다.
- 패킷이 순서대로 도착하지 않을 수도 있고, 패킷이 누락될 수도 있기 때문에 패킷에는 번호를 붙인다.
- 큰 데이터는 작은 패킷으로 분할한다.
정보의 양을 나타내는 단위#
- 비트: 정보의 최소 단위로 0 또는 1을 나타낸다.
- 8비트 = 1바이트
- 문자 코드의 경우는 각 문자에 대응하는 숫자를 정해두고 이 대응표를 확인해서 문자로 변환한다.
랜과 왠#
- LAN: 비교적 가까운 거리에 위치한 장비들을 서로 연결한 네트워크를 말한다. 집, 사무소 등을 연결하는 네트워크다.
- WAN: LAN을 다시 하나로 묶는 거대한 네트워크다. 특정 도시, 국가, 대륙과 같이 매우 넓은 범위를 연결하는 네트워크다.
- ISP: 인터넷에 접속하는 수단을 제공하는 주체다. KT, U+, SK브로드밴드와 같은 회사가 있다.
- ISP가 제공하는 서비스를 사용하여 구축한 네트워크를 WAN이라고 한다.
- LAN은 일반적으로 랜 케이블로 연결하고, 거리가 짧기 때문에 속도가 빠르며 오류가 발생할 확률이 낮다.
- WAN은 속도가 느리고, 거리가 멀기 때문에 오류가 발생할 확률이 높다.
가정에서 하는 랜 구성#
- 가정에서는 일반적으로 인터넷 공유기를 중심으로 LAN을 구성하고, 다양한 기기를 연결한다.
- 랜 케이블을 사용하면 유선 랜, 케이블이 필요하지 않으면 무선 랜이다.
- 인터넷을 구성하기 위해서는 ISP와 인터넷 회선을 결정해야된다.
(소규모) 회사에서 하는 랜 구성#
- DMZ라는 네트워크 영역이 있다.
- DMZ: 외부 네트워크와 내부 네트워크 사이에 위치한 중간 지대(서브넷)을 말한다. 네트워크의 보안 영역으로 외부 공격자가 내부 네트워크에 침투하는 것을 막는 역할을 한다.
- 불특정 다수의 외부 사용자에게 공개하기 위한 웹 서버, 메일 서버, DNS 서버 등을 DMZ 네트워크에 포함시킨다.
- 회사에서는 서버를 운영하기 위해서 온프레미스(on-premise) 또는 클라우드(cloud) 방식을 사용한다.
- 온프레미스 경우에는 회사 내에 서버 장비실을 두고 그 곳에 랙을 설치한다. 랙 안에 서버를 두고 관리한다.
- 랙 안에 랙을 설치하기 위해 서버, 라우터, 스위치를 설치할 수도 있다.
comments powered by